AI Technical Summary
Existing gun and ammunition cabinets require manual operation to store and retrieve firearms and ammunition, making the opening and closing process cumbersome, unable to achieve rapid response and intelligent management, and unable to ensure security and dynamic tracking of firearms.
The system employs an automatic opening and closing mechanism, an RFID identification system, and a biometric module. Combined with the design of a rotating motor, linkage rod, and sliding groove, it enables automatic opening and closing of the cabinet door and identifies and dynamically tracks firearms through an RFID antenna and a firearm locator.
It improves the convenience and efficiency of storing and retrieving firearms and ammunition, ensures the safety of the storage and retrieval process, and realizes in-situ monitoring of firearms in the management cabinet and dynamic tracking after they leave, thus achieving intelligent management.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of gun cabinet, specifically points to a kind of intelligent gun management cabinet. BACKGROUND
[0002] Gun cabinet is the container for keeping gun and ammunition. Gun and ammunition have great killing power, and they need to be maintained and placed safely to avoid wear and tear or theft. The storage and management of gun and ammunition are important aspects of current public security and army informatization construction.
[0003] The existing gun cabinet needs to manually rotate the key and / or manually operate the complex mechanical lock when storing and taking out the gun and bullets, and cannot realize the automatic opening and closing of the cabinet door, resulting in a cumbersome opening and closing process of the cabinet door, which is inconvenient and inefficient, and cannot be applied to police work, security and other application scenarios that require quick response, so as to improve the convenience and efficiency of storing and taking out the gun and bullets. When storing and taking out the gun and bullets, safety cannot be ensured, the label information on the gun cannot be identified, the gun cannot be monitored in place when it is in the management cabinet, and the gun cannot be dynamically tracked after it leaves the management cabinet. Overall, intelligent management cannot be realized.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ION
[0032] For the convenience of those skilled in the art to understand, the structure of the utility model will be further described in detail in combination with the drawings:
[0033] Reference Figures 1-5 An intelligent gun management cabinet, comprising:
[0034] The cabinet body 1 is pivoted at the front end with two cabinet doors 2 arranged symmetrically;
[0035] The gun bullet storage unit comprises a handgun lock 3, a long gun lock 4 and at least one bullet drawer arranged inside the cabinet body 1;
[0036] The automatic opening and closing mechanism comprises two rotating motors 5 arranged at the top end inside the cabinet body 1, a connecting plate 6 fixedly connected to the inner wall of the cabinet door 2, a linkage rod 7 having two ends connected to the output shaft of the rotating motor 5 and the connecting plate 6 respectively, and the linkage rod 7 and the connecting plate 6 form a sliding pair;
[0037] The intelligent management and control system comprises:
[0038] The RFID reading device embedded in one of the cabinet doors 2 comprises an RFID reader 8 and a plurality of RFID antennas 9 embedded in one of the cabinet doors 2;
[0039] A charging base 10 is arranged in the cabinet body 1, and a gun positioner 11 is arranged on the charging base 10, one of the cabinet doors 2 is integrated with an operation display screen 12 and a biometric identification module 13 at the front end, and a control mainboard (not shown) is arranged in the cabinet body 1;
[0040] The handgun lock 3, the long gun lock 4, the bullet drawer, the rotating motor 5, the RFID reader 8, the charging base 10, the operation display screen 12 and the biometric identification module 13 are electrically connected to the control mainboard, the RFID reader 8 is connected to the plurality of RFID antennas 9, and the gun positioner 11 is connected to the charging base 10.
[0041] The automatic opening and closing mechanism can realize automatic opening and closing of the cabinet door without manually rotating the key and / or manually operating the complex mechanical lock when accessing the gun and the bullet, and the automatic opening and closing process of the cabinet door is not only convenient but also efficient, which can be applied to police work, security and other application scenarios requiring rapid response, thereby improving the convenience and efficiency of accessing the gun and the bullet.
[0042] The gun locator 11 is connected to the charging base 10 by magnetic attraction, the charging base 10 can charge the gun locator 11, the charging base 10 is provided with the function of monitoring the battery power of the gun locator 11, the RFID reader 8 is used for reading and processing signals, and the RFID antenna 9 is used for transmitting and receiving signals.
[0043] The connecting plate 6 is provided with a sliding groove 14, a sliding rod 15 is arranged in the sliding groove 14, the bottom end of the sliding rod 15 is hinged to the linkage rod 7, and the top end of the sliding rod 15 is provided with a limiting block 16 with a diameter greater than the width of the sliding groove 14.
[0044] The stroke distance of the sliding rod 15 in the sliding groove 14 is equal to the corresponding arc length of the maximum opening angle of the cabinet door 2.
[0045] A plurality of RFID antennas 9 are arranged on one of the cabinet doors 2, and a plurality of RFID antennas 9 are distributed around the handgun lock 3 and the long gun lock 4.
[0046] The bullet drawer includes a drawer body 17 arranged in the cabinet body 1, the inner bottom end surface of the drawer body 17 is provided with a plurality of bullet recesses (not shown) with pressure sensors, the front end surface of the drawer body 17 is provided with a touch control screen 18, and an electric push rod (not shown) is arranged between the drawer body 17 and the cabinet body 1. The pressure sensor, the touch control screen 18 and the electric push rod are electrically connected to the control mainboard.
[0047] The bullet drawer can display the number of bullets and the inventory status, and can automatically eject and retract the cabinet body 1. A plurality of bullet recesses are arranged in a matrix on the inner bottom end surface of the drawer body 17.
[0048] The biometric identification module 13 integrates a fingerprint identification unit, an iris scanning unit and a face recognition camera.
[0049] The three kinds of fingerprint identification unit, iris scanning unit and face recognition camera have small cooperation misrecognition probability, which further improves the security and accuracy of identification.
[0050] The gun locator 11 includes a gun positioning shell, a Beidou chip, a communication module, an acceleration sensor, a power module, an RFID reader, an RFID auxiliary antenna and a controller are arranged in the gun positioning shell, the Beidou chip, the communication module, the acceleration sensor, the power module and the RFID reader are electrically connected to the controller, and the RFID reader is connected to the RFID auxiliary antenna.
[0051] The RFID reader is used for reading and processing signals, and the RFID auxiliary antenna is used for transmitting and receiving signals.
[0052] Two cabinet doors 2 are provided with an electromagnetic interlocking mechanism, including a permanent magnet 19 embedded in one of the cabinet doors 2, an electromagnetic lock 20 provided on the other cabinet door 2 and matched with the permanent magnet 19, and an emergency button 21 provided on the front end face of one of the cabinet doors 2. An audible and visual alarm device (not shown) is provided on the cabinet 1, and the electromagnetic lock 20, the emergency button 21 and the audible and visual alarm device are electrically connected with a control mainboard.
[0053] The electromagnetic lock 20 generates an adsorption force with the permanent magnet 19 when the two cabinet doors 2 are closed.
[0054] The cabinet 1 is made of stainless steel, and the bolt of the handgun lock 3 is matched with the corresponding gun profile. The handgun lock 3 can adopt a three-point electromagnetic locking structure or other structures, and the long gun lock 4 is provided with a barrel buckle and a trigger guard lock.
[0055] The operation display screen 12 is a 12-inch internal and external double-screen capacitive touch screen, which can provide interfaces such as data visualization, data display, record query and emergency unlocking function. The touch control screen 18 is a 3.5-inch touch screen, which has better display effect and can meet the information display and operation requirements, and has better convenience.
[0056] The positions of the plurality of RFID antennas 9 can be arranged according to the type and frequency of use of the gun. For example, for the placement area of commonly used guns, the number of RFID antennas 9 is appropriately increased, and a cross net layout can be adopted to improve the detection accuracy and signal coverage range of the area; for the placement area of standby guns, the number of RFID antennas 9 is appropriately reduced, and a linear layout can be adopted to reduce the cost and signal interference on the premise of ensuring basic identification function.
[0057] When designing a new layout, electromagnetic simulation software is used to simulate and analyze the internal electromagnetic field distribution of the cabinet 1, and the positions and angles of the RFID antennas 9 are optimized to ensure that the guns in different placement areas can be accurately identified.
[0058] Under the premise of meeting the gun identification accuracy requirements, the number of RFID antennas 9 is adjusted according to the capacity of the cabinet 1 and the actual application scene. If the cabinet 1 is small and the number of stored guns is limited, the number of RFID antennas 9 can be appropriately reduced, such as from the original 4 to 2, and the identification effect is ensured by reasonably adjusting the positions and power of the RFID antennas 9; if the cabinet 1 is large and the guns are stored more dispersedly, the number of RFID antennas 9 can be increased to 6 or even more, and distributed antenna array technology can be adopted to enhance the overall identification capability and avoid signal conflict between too many RFID antennas 9.
[0059] The management cabinet can be connected with external commercial power supply, or a power supply device is arranged in the cabinet body 1 of the management cabinet, and the power supply device is electrically connected with the control mainboard.
[0060] The working principle of the utility model is as follows:
[0061] The user approaches the cabinet body 1, the biological recognition module 13 recognizes the user, and after the recognition is passed, the operation display screen 12 is operated, then the electromagnetic interlocking mechanism is unlocked, then the rotating motor 5 is driven, and the cabinet door 2 is opened under the cooperation of the connecting plate 6, the linkage rod 7, the sliding groove 14, the sliding rod 15 and the limiting block 16, the RFID reader-writer 8 and the multiple RFID antennas 9 cooperate to recognize the label information on the gun, then the gun lock is unlocked, and the gun lock and the biological recognition module 13 cooperate to ensure safety when the gun and the bullets are stored and taken out.
[0062] The drawer body 17 is pulled out by the electric push rod, the user takes out the gun and the bullets, the drawer body 17 is pulled back by the electric push rod, the number of bullets and the inventory state are displayed on the touch control screen 18 through the counting of the multiple bullet concave pits with pressure sensors, the operation display screen 12 is operated, the rotating motor 5 is driven, and the cabinet door 2 is closed under the cooperation of the connecting plate 6, the linkage rod 7, the sliding groove 14, the sliding rod 15 and the limiting block 16, then the electromagnetic interlocking mechanism is locked.
[0063] The gun positioner 11 is worn on the user after being taken off, is positioned in real time through the Beidou chip, and when the distance between the RFID reader, the RFID auxiliary antenna and the label information on the gun exceeds a predetermined value, alarm information and positioning information are sent to the upper computer through the communication module, so that the upper computer records and processes, the risk that the gun is stolen or lost is reduced, the position of the user and the gun can be quickly positioned in an emergency, safety is improved, and the gun can be dynamically tracked after leaving the management cabinet.
[0064] The user approaches the cabinet body 1, the biological recognition module 13 recognizes the user, and after the recognition is passed, the operation display screen 12 is operated, then the electromagnetic interlocking mechanism is unlocked, then the rotating motor 5 is driven, and the cabinet door 2 is opened under the cooperation of the connecting plate 6, the linkage rod 7, the sliding groove 14, the sliding rod 15 and the limiting block 16.
[0065] Operation touch control screen 18, drawer body 17 is ejected by electric push rod, the user will put the gun and bullets into the gun lock and drawer body 17 respectively, RFID reader 8, multiple RFID antennas 9 cooperate to identify the tag information on the gun, and the corresponding gun lock is locked after no exception, RFID reader 8, multiple RFID antennas 9 cooperate to identify the tag information on the gun, and the data is transmitted to the control mainboard, the cooperation of RFID reader 8, multiple RFID antennas 9 and gun lock can confirm the authenticity of the stored gun and whether the gun is correctly in place, further improve the accuracy, precision and stability of gun management, effectively avoid gun misjudgment and management loopholes, so that the gun can be monitored in place when it is in the management cabinet.
[0066] Operation touch control screen 18, electric push rod makes drawer body 17 retract, count the number of bullets through a number of bullet concave pits with pressure sensors, and display the number of bullets and inventory status on the touch control screen 18, operate the operation display screen 12, rotate the motor 5 drive, and complete the closing of the cabinet door 2 under the cooperation of the connecting plate 6, the linkage rod 7, the sliding groove 14, the sliding rod 15 and the limiting block 16, and then the electromagnetic interlocking mechanism is locked.
[0067] The control mainboard can analyze the access frequency of each gun and generate maintenance reminders, reduce the frequency of manual inspection, and can compare the RFID reader 8, multiple RFID antennas 9 cooperate to identify the tag information on the gun with the preset gun archive library in real time, when an unauthorized gun is stored or an authorized gun is abnormally removed from the cabinet, trigger the audible and light alarm device and close the two cabinet doors 2 and lock the cabinet doors 2 by the electromagnetic interlocking mechanism.
[0068] In emergency situations, press the emergency button 21, the electromagnetic interlocking mechanism is forcibly powered off and unlocked, at the same time, the audible and light alarm device is started to alarm.
[0069] The control mainboard cooperates with the biological recognition module 13 to match multiple levels of operation permissions according to the biological recognition result, which can be set as: the first level permission only allows to view the gun and bullet inventory status on the operation display screen 12, the second level permission can open the specified gun lock, and the third level permission has the cabinet door 2 opening and closing, emergency unlocking and system setting permissions.
